Police investigating a robbery want to speak to a man with an uncanny resemblance to football star – Wayne Rooney
The alert was issued after thieves raided an upmarket apartment and made off with thousands of pounds worth of goods.
One of the men sought in connection with the crime is a doppelganger for Man United and England star Rooney, 27.

The spitting image suspect walks with the same swagger and appears to have the same stubble, hairline, physique and have the same taste in sport casual wear.
Avon and Somerset Police said the robbery took place at midday on October 19 with a neighbour filming the two men acting suspiciously.
At the time of the raid in Bristol, Rooney was preparing for a match against Stoke City, where he hit the back of the net twice and scored and an own goal.

A police spokesperson said: “The images show two men in the area at the time who might have important information which could help us with our enquiries.
“The burglary occurred at midday when a window was forced and several rooms searched.
“We are investigating and attended the scene at the time to search the area.
“That day we also spoke to various pawn shops and gold-buying shops to alert them to the stolen items and circulated these images to police officers to see if anyone could identify them.”
